@aaminashifa: The amount of "go back to the kitchen" comments I've received over the years is honestly insane. Most of the time, I laugh them off and move on. But the truth is that for many women around the world, these attitudes aren't jokes-they're a lived reality. Many women are raised to believe that they belong only in the kitchen, only in the home, or only within the narrow boundaries that others have set for them. And that mindset doesn't stop there, it seeps into every aspect of their lives. It shapes what they believe they're capable of, what opportunities they pursue, and how much space they feel allowed to take up in the world. I can attest to this because of the countless messages I've received from women across the globe. Women who feel trapped. Women who have been discouraged from pursuing education, careers, sports, leadership, or simply the things that make them feel alive. Women who have been forced into boxes they never chose for themselves. The purpose behind this page has never been to tell women who they should become. It's been to remind them that they don't have to compromise who they are, their values, or their ambitions because of other’s expectations. You do not have to shrink yourself to make other people comfortable. You do not have to accept limitations that were placed on you by culture, fear, or other people's opinions. And you do not have to confuse cultural restrictions with what Islam actually teaches. Islam was never sent to diminish women. It was sent to honour them, empower them, and grant them rights that many societies denied them. The challenge is learning to distinguish between the teachings of our faith and the cultural narratives that are often spoken in its name. What I love most is that when women watch my videos, I don't want them to see me. I want them to see themselves. Because this was never really about getting on a galloping horse and shooting a bow. What matters is what it represents. It's about challenging limitations. It's about breaking stereotypes. It's about having the courage to pursue something that others said wasn't meant for you. When a woman watches my videos, I don't want her to think, "Wow, look what she's doing." I want her to think, "If she can do that, what am I capable of?". Because every woman has her own version of the horse and bow. For some, it's pursuing higher education. For others, it's starting a business, pursuing a career, travelling, playing a sport, speaking up, taking up space, or having the courage to dream bigger than they've been told they're allowed to. My hope has always been that this page serves as a mirror, not a spotlight. A reminder that the things you admire in others often exist within you too. So take up space. Pursue what inspires you.
